TEMPO.CO, Jakarta - Apart from the discussions on Jakarta’s May 22 riots’ alleged human rights violations, Amnesty International Indonesia also talked about the joint investigation on Novel Baswedan’s acid attack that happened over a year ago.
“The main agenda is surely the May 22 riots. But there is also Novel Baswedan’s case,” said Usman Hamid, Amnesty Internasional Indonesia Director at Metro Jaya Police headquarters on July 9.
According to Usman, the discussion of the two incidents is related to the fact-finding search team’s tenure that officially ended on July 7. The team was exclusively formed to handle the case.
Usman hoped the meeting, which was attended by the Metro Jaya Police Chief, would eventually produce the report on the development of Novel’s case.
“We certainly hope that the investigation would produce a solution and significant development from the team under the leadership of the police chief,” said the Amnesty director.
The fact-finding team that was tasked to solve Novel’s case admitted that they are facing difficulties upon solving the acid attack on one of Corruption Eradication Commission (KPK) senior investigators.
“It’s not easy to investigate such a case. For those who say it’s easy, please give us clues,” said Hendardi, one member of the fact-finding team from Setara Institute on Monday, July 8.
The investigation on Novel’s case is officially complete but the report has yet been publicized. They plan on presenting their findings to the Indonesian National Police Chief Tito Karnavian this week.
